## Step 4: Configure the assignment service

Before promoting Splitwing's assignment service to production, verify that the bucketing seed matches the one used during the Kestrel Labs dry run; a mismatch will silently re-randomize every active experiment cohort and corrupt two weeks of metrics. Double-check the rollout percentage in the manifest, confirm the sticky-assignment flag is enabled, and only then open the environment file on the deploy host. Add the signing secret used to authenticate cohort lookups on the next line.

env line for kajog-yahop: VAULT_KEY20=08bff06bfb9f0d320dc3

Finance Review — Insurance Renewal. The Hallowmere Group policy with Bryantell Mutual renews 1 March. Premium up 9% on prior year, driven by the Westcliff depot claims. Coverage limits unchanged; cyber rider added at marginal cost. Deductibles hold at current levels. Finance recommends renewal as quoted; broker tender deferred to next cycle. Department heads should confirm asset schedules by 14 February. No budget variance expected beyond the approved contingency. The following note is restricted to this distribution.

board note of tawig-bajof: The renewal with Ralixix Holdings closes at $10 million a year, 20 percent above the last contract. Project Druix slips by two quarters because of the tooling delay.

Garage occupancy feed tests flaking on the Stonewick CI pool again. Cause: the mock sensor fixture emits counts faster than the Lorris ingest stub drains them, so assertions race. Not a product bug. Workaround: pin the fixture tick rate in the pipeline config before cutting the release. The first pipeline run exhibiting the flake carries the token below.

trace token, fafog-kageg: htk4_98e6

## Runbook: Retrying Failed Exports (Brindlecast)

Failed exports land in the `export_retry` queue. Retries are automatic up to the max attempt count; after that they park in dead-letter. Manual replay: use the ops CLI, never requeue by editing rows. Replays are idempotent. Do not replay during the nightly compaction window — it doubles write load. If dead-letter exceeds a few hundred items, page the storage rotation instead. The retry behavior is governed by the following settings.

config for kafof-bawef:
holath:
  log_level: debug
  metrics_host: metrics.holath.qorvelsys.internal
  pin: 2191
  pool_size: 32